Game keeps crashing after starting black screen then crash

Hi, 

For already 6 months everytime i started the game ( EA APP) it was always the same, first small image with soldiers ( banner ) loading anticheat and different things, then the minimized black screen appears and after some seconds the game starts in full screen mode, all great...

Now a couple of days ago i run a full scan with  antivirus Bitdefender, 5 threads were eleminated, after this, BF6 start having issues, now everytime i start the game, first i see the soldiers banner kind of like stuck not doing anyhing, then it closes and nothing happen, then i re start the game hitting play on the game on EA app or double click in desktop BF6 icon, the the banner appeas again, this time starts loading anticheat, etc, after finish, black screen starts... after some seconds, CRASH, this already happened like 10 times or more, i cannot play the game, i don't even reach the Main Menu of the game.

I already unninstall anticheat, unninstall and re install EA app, unninstall and re install BF 6, repair more than 3 times BF 6 in EA app, i also execute the anticheat and hit reapir and select where BF6 folder is installed. Also i unninstall BitDefender antivirus , nothing fixed the issue, i cannot play anymore. Please HELP

  • Today i also tried this and it didn't work .

    1. Open CMD application as administrator
    2. type in this command dism /online /cleanup-image /restorehealth (DO NOT BE IMPATIENT, THIS PROCESS WILL TAKE A FEW MINUTES)
    3. After it says the process is completed, type this command sfc /scannow (THIS WILL TAKE A FEW MINUTES AS WELL)
    4. After completion, Restart PC.
    5. Run through the steps again, if the SFC command prompt says there are no files to repair, you are good. If it says it found more files that needed repair, restart PC and run through the steps again until it says there were no files to repair. Run your game and it should get past the shader compilation.
